1a66715320 main: set umask to 077 instead of 022
It was reported that PulseAudio weakens the umask to 022 if it's
initially set to 077. That's not as big problem as it might seem,
but it's still a problem. The umask affects the permissions of the state
files, and those aren't readable by other users anyway in the per-user
mode, because PulseAudio puts them in directories that aren't
accessible to other users. In the system mode the state files will be
readable by everyone, though, even by those users that don't otherwise
have access to PulseAudio. The state files are slightly
privacy-sensitive, because they contain e.g. history of applications
that have used PulseAudio.

I can't think of any use cases where access to the state files by other
users would be necessary, either in the per-user mode or in the system
mode, so let's use umask 077. This doesn't prevent access to any
sockets in the system mode, because all directories that PulseAudio
creates in the system mode will have permissions 755 regardless of the
umask, and the sockets themselves always have permissions 777.

cc021c7330 sink, source: Add a mode to avoid resampling if possible
This adds an "avoid-resampling" option to daemon.conf that makes the
daemon try to use the stream sample rate if possible (the device needs
to support it, which currently only ALSA does), and there should not be
any other stream connected).

This should enable some of the "audiophile" use-cases where users wish
to play high sample rate audio files without resampling.

We still will do conversion if sample formats don't match, though. This
means that if you want to play 96 kHz/24 bit audio without any
modification the default format will need to be set to be 24-bit as
well. This will force all streams to be upconverted, which, other than
the wasted resources, should be relatively harmless.

7cb524a77b launch: make pulseaudio.service properly order and require the socket
This commit fixes two problems:

1. Because there are no implicit dependencies between sockets and services,
   the socket, as set up by systemd will race with the socket, as set up
   by the pulseaudio daemon. This can cause the pulseaudio.socket unit to
   fail (even though the pulseaudio service started just fine), which can
   confuse users.
2. While it is possible to use the service without the socket, it is not
   clear why it would be desirable. And a user installing pulseaudio and
   doing `systemctl --user start pulseaudio` will not get the socket
   started, which might be confusing and problematic if the server is to
   be restarted later on, as the client autospawn feature might kick in.

adbaae77d6 Disable LFE remixing by default
The current LFE crossover filter removes low frequencies from the main
channels and puts them into the LFE channel with the wrong amplitude.
It is not known for sure what is the correct relative amplitude (acoustic
measurements are required with real hardware), and changing that might
introduce a new bug, "it clips the LFE channel".

So just disable the feature by default until a better understanding
emerges how it should work. This, essentially, returns the defaults
to their state as of PulseAudio 6.0.

Some more observations:

- Most of available active analog speakers on the market do the
necessary crossover filtering already, and HDMI receivers can be
configured to do that, too, so a crossover filter in PulseAudio is
harmful in these use cases.

- The "laptop with a builtin subwoofer" use case requires manual
configuration anyway because the default crossover frequency (120 Hz) is
wrong for laptop speakers.

- Finally, Windows 10 with a built-in USB audio driver does not synthesize
the LFE channel given a 5.1 card and a stereo audio stream by default.

7b9fcc01f6 client-conf, daemon-conf: enable .d directories
I want to enable client.conf.d, because in OpenEmbedded-core we have
a graphical environment called Sato that runs as root. Sato needs to
set allow-autospawn-for-root=true in client.conf, but the default
configuration in OpenEmbedded-core should not set that option. With
this patch, I can create a Sato-specific package that simply installs
50-sato.conf in /etc/pulse/client.conf.d without conflicting with the
main client.conf coming from a different package.

daemon.conf.d is enabled just because it would be strange to not
support it while client.conf.d is supported.

cf0cd5fe18 daemon: Exit with code 0 on SIGINT and SIGTERM
see https://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=86818

an exit code of 1 makes systemd believe that the service failed;
better return 0 to denote that PA sucessfully stopped on the user's
request

sidenote: systemd's SuccessExitStatus= could be used to turn code 1 into a
code denoting success

42156d2b5a launch: Avoid specifically starting PA and rely on autospawn/socket activation
This --start is patched out in several downstreams to allow users to easily
disable PA by simply disabling autospawn.

If autospawn is enabled, then the first pactl command will start it and if not
it will fail and the script will exit.

When switching to systemd socket activation, we very much do not want to
start PA manually here. We could replace it with a
  systemctl --user start pulseaudio
but really it just makes sense to rely on the socket activation as this
should apply equally to non-systemd setups which use PA's own autospawn.
